Meaning of 銀 in Japanese
Japanese word definition and usage
-
銀, 白銀, 白金JLPT 3
-
Kana Readingぎん, しろがね
-
Romajigin, shirogane
-
Word Senses
-
- Parts of speech
- noun (common) (futsuumeishi), nouns which may take the genitive case particle `no`
- Meaning
- silver; silver coin; silver paint
-
- Parts of speech
- noun (common) (futsuumeishi)
- Meaning
- silver general (shogi)
